A leading recruitment firm seeks a Graduate Sales Executive to join their London team. The role involves selling attendance packages to senior executives from major companies while providing excellent training and a clear promotion path. Candidates should display confidence, curiosity, and a strong drive to excel. With hybrid working opportunities and international travel, it’s an exciting chance for early-career professionals in a dynamic environment.

✨Know Your Sales Methodologies
Brush up on popular sales methodologies like SPIN Selling or Challenger Sales. Being able to discuss these techniques and how you've applied them will show Jackson Barnes that you understand the role and can hit the ground running in the sales game.
